First and foremost, one of the primary benefits of sealing your concrete driveway is protection from the elements. Concrete driveways are constantly exposed to harsh weather conditions, including sun, rain, and snow. Over time, these elements can cause cracks, discoloration, and other forms of damage. By applying a high-quality concrete sealant, you create a protective barrier that helps safeguard against these environmental factors.
Another significant advantage of sealing your driveway is resistance to staining. Oil spills, tire marks, and other contaminants can leave unsightly stains on unsealed concrete, diminishing your driveway's visual appeal. A sealant acts as a preventer, making it difficult for substances to penetrate the concrete surface. This resistance to stains not only keeps your driveway looking clean but also reduces the time and effort needed for maintenance.
In addition to its protective qualities, sealing your concrete driveway can enhance its appearance. A well-applied sealant can bring out the natural beauty and color of the concrete, giving it a fresh and polished look. This aesthetic enhancement can increase curb appeal, making your home more attractive to potential buyers should you decide to sell.
Sealing your driveway can also contribute to its longevity. By preventing moisture from penetrating the concrete, the risk of damage due to freeze-thaw cycles is significantly reduced. These cycles can cause severe cracking if the concrete absorbs water that then freezes and expands. Over time, this damage can lead to costly repairs or even the need to replace the entire driveway. Regularly sealing the concrete is an investment in extending the life of your driveway.
The safety aspect of a sealed concrete driveway is another important factor. Unsealed concrete can become slippery when wet, posing a hazard to you and your family. Certain sealants can offer slip-resistant properties, providing an extra layer of safety, particularly in areas prone to heavy rainfall or icy conditions.
Finally, sealing your driveway is a cost-effective measure. The initial investment in a sealant is relatively low compared to the potential expense of repairing or replacing a damaged driveway. By maintaining the integrity of the concrete, you can avoid substantial repair costs down the line.
